## What is the function of cross joint bearing?

1. **What is a cross joint bearing?**.

Cross joint bearing, also known as universal joint or U-joint, is a type of mechanical component used to connect shafts that are not in line with each other. It consists of four needle bearings, two bearing caps, and a cross-shaped body.

2. **What is the function of a cross joint bearing?**.

The primary function of a cross joint bearing is to transmit torque (rotational force) between two shafts at different angles while allowing for some degree of misalignment. This helps to compensate for any misalignment between the shafts and allows for smooth and efficient power transmission.

3. **How does a cross joint bearing work?**.

The needle bearings inside the cross joint bearing allow for the smooth transfer of torque from one shaft to another, even when they are not perfectly aligned. The cross-shaped body connects the four needle bearings and allows for flexibility when the shafts are at different angles or distances from each other.

4. **Where are cross joint bearings used?**.

Cross joint bearings are commonly found in various automotive applications, such as in driveshafts and steering systems. They are also used in industrial machinery, agriculture equipment, and other mechanical systems where torque needs to be transmitted between non-aligned shafts.

5. **Why are cross joint bearings important?**.

Cross joint bearings play a crucial role in ensuring that power is transmitted efficiently and smoothly between shafts that are not in line with each other. By allowing for some degree of misalignment, they help to prevent premature wear and damage to the connected components.

In conclusion, cross joint bearings are essential components in machinery and equipment where torque needs to be transmitted between shafts at different angles. Their ability to accommodate misalignment and provide smooth power transmission makes them a vital part of many mechanical systems.
